The Summer Abundance Harvest Box brings to you the greatest yields from the garden. This box will feature organically grown tomatoes sun-ripened on the vine and an array of farm-fresh vegetables that express the true flavours of summer in the Valley. Members also have the option to include a bouquet of flowers from our garden in lieu of produce item.

As the nights start to chill, many of our field vegetables benefit from and receive accentuated flavour. The summer crops, made sweeter by cool nights, give out the last of their fruits and fall favorites such as winter squash, leeks, and crisp radishes make their welcome return. With our Greenhouse space, we are able to continue to provide you with farm-fresh tomatoes and cucumbers.
